Eagle Nuclear Engages Tensor Medium for SMR Optimization, Leverages 32.75M lbs Uranium Deposit
SMR•Eagle Nuclear Energy Corp has engaged Tensor Medium Corporation to support reactor simulation, optimization, quantum development, and licensing-readiness for its small modular reactor program. The company holds 32.75 million pounds indicated and 4.98 million pounds inferred uranium at its Aurora deposit, targeting a pre-feasibility study in H2 2027.

3. Aurora Uranium Deposit
The Aurora deposit in southeastern Oregon contains 32.75 million pounds indicated and 4.98 million pounds inferred uranium resources under an S-K 1300 report, making it the largest conventional uranium deposit in the United States.
4. Pre-feasibility Timeline
Eagle Nuclear targets completion of a pre-feasibility study for its uranium resources in the second half of 2027, which will inform resource development while parallel SMR optimization proceeds toward future licensing applications.
